The Department of Budget and Management (DBM) has approved the request of the University of the Philippines (UP) Manila – Philippine General Hospital (PGH) to create 1,224 additional positions to augment the existing medical and support staff of the country’s premier government hospital.

In a media release Thursday, Budget Secretary Amenah Pangandaman said the additional manpower would allow the PGH to “continue to stand as a beacon of medical excellence in the country.”

“Alinsunod po ito sa direktiba ng ating Pangulong Bongbong Marcos na mabigyan natin ng mas mahusay at maasahang serbisyo ang mga kababayan nating nangangailangan (This is in line with the directive of President Ferdinand R. Marcos Jr. to provide better and reliable service to all FIlipinos in need),” Pangandaman said.

The UP-PGH is a Level III general hospital with 1,334 bed capacity.

According to the DBM, the creation of additional positions will be pursued in four tranches, starting in the first quarter of 2025, the fourth quarter of 2025, and in 2026 and 2027. (PNA)
